Eligibility for SSDI in Bakersfield requires a medical condition that prevents substantial gainful activity and is expected to last at least one year or lead to death. The Social Security Administration follows a five-step evaluation process. Professionals can help you present your case effectively to meet these criteria.

SSDI is for individuals who have worked and paid Social Security taxes, while SSI is a needs-based program for those with disabilities and limited income. Both programs provide financial support, but the eligibility rules differ. Understanding this distinction is key to filing the correct claim in Bakersfield.
Your SSDI benefit amount is calculated based on your average lifetime earnings and the Social Security taxes you've paid. There is a maximum monthly benefit amount. Professionals can provide an estimate of what you might receive based on your work history.
